Transaction ed6f7685f16a49e89ffbd34850baa569697081479a76b997a22d4558e228d782
1 Input
1 Output
-
ed6f7685f16a49e89ffbd34850baa569697081479a76b997a22d4558e228d782:0
- value
- 258447
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cd573bb39dc6d57689ab1b96ef16572c0f7729e OP_EQUAL
- address
- 3Qjsuo5RZBmG793S1qAtem2CHTgLtxv62n